The objective of a topographic study is to situate both all-natural and man-made topographic attributes on a parcel. It explains elevation, offering an overview of surface features such as a synopsis of surface attributes, such as streams and hills, and any man-made attributes, such as structures and roads. A topographic survey consists of various attributes such as fencings, utilities, buildings, elevations, streams, trees, enhancements, and contours. It is usually required by federal government firms and made use of by architects and engineers for website planning and development.

An accredited land surveyor figures out the location of document limit lines based upon the evaluation of numerous pieces of info. A survey will document record right( s) of method, deeded or mapped easements, and encroachments both ways over border lines. Lines of line of work (fence, side of lawn, bush, and so on) will additionally be revealed or otherwise documented. Throughout the course of a survey, a surveyor will certainly review title documents and study the parcel deed and the deeds of the surrounding homes.
